Output d6376fcfd46b6d1a7c7565c324d0bad005a33c15fe1768f83c4f98eb418e6349:38

value
4384664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a3a42ca23df23f8ee9ef9344faf2a10bd86e73f OP_EQUAL
address
35YJ6dztnZUvHedPGqHi3mZiFAZ7vQgRP2
transaction
d6376fcfd46b6d1a7c7565c324d0bad005a33c15fe1768f83c4f98eb418e6349
spent
true